Understanding Common Causes of Battery Leaks and Explosions
Battery leaks and explosions often stem from a few critical factors that users might overlook. One of the primary causes is improper charging, where using incompatible chargers or overcharging causes internal overheating. This heat can build up pressure inside the battery, leading to swelling, leaks of harmful electrolytes, or, in worst cases, catastrophic explosions. Physical damage is another significant contributor; puncturing or dropping batteries can compromise their internal structure, triggering chemical reactions that result in leaks or even fires.
Environmental conditions play a vital role as well. Exposure to extreme temperatures-both hot and cold-can accelerate chemical instability within batteries. Additionally, mixing different types or brands of batteries in a single device can cause uneven discharge rates or short-circuiting, increasing the risk of leakage or explosive failure. Understanding these causes highlights why proper handling, storage, and maintenance truly matter when it comes to battery safety.
- Avoid overcharging by using manufacturer-recommended chargers.
- Handle batteries carefully to prevent dents or punctures.
- Store batteries in cool, dry conditions away from direct sunlight.
- Never mix battery types or old with new.
Safe Handling and Storage Practices to Extend Battery Life
Proper battery care begins with conscientious handling practices that prevent physical damage and chemical deterioration. Always avoid dropping or exposing batteries to shock, as dents or punctures can lead to internal short circuits, increasing the risk of leaks or explosions. When inserting batteries, ensure correct polarity alignment to prevent overheating. Keep battery terminals clean and free from corrosion by gently wiping them with a dry cloth. Additionally, refrain from mixing old and new batteries or different brands, which can cause uneven discharge and leakage. Handling batteries with dry hands and avoiding contact with metal objects minimizes accidental short circuits, making your usage safer and more efficient.
Storage plays a crucial role in prolonging battery lifespan and maintaining safety standards. Store batteries in a cool, dry place away from direct sunlight or heat sources, as excessive temperatures accelerate chemical breakdown. Use original packaging or dedicated battery cases to prevent contact between batteries, effectively eliminating the risk of accidental shorts. It’s also best to store batteries at moderate charge levels rather than fully drained or fully charged to preserve their health. To ensure consistent performance and reduce risks, regularly inspect stored batteries for signs of swelling, corrosion, or leaks, and dispose of damaged ones responsibly using designated recycling facilities.
- Keep batteries dry and clean, avoiding moisture buildup that can corrode contacts.
- Never expose them to extreme temperatures, both hot and cold.
- Store batteries separately to avoid electrical shorts.
- Use protective cases when transporting batteries.
- Check batteries regularly for any signs of damage or leakage.
Choosing the Right Battery Type for Your Devices
Selecting the ideal power source for your electronic devices is crucial not just for performance but also for safety. Different batteries have unique chemical compositions and capabilities, which impact their longevity, energy output, and risk factors like leakage or explosion. For instance, alkaline batteries are often a reliable choice for low-drain devices due to their stable voltage and resistance to leakage, while lithium-ion batteries power high-demand gadgets like smartphones and laptops but require careful handling because of their sensitivity to overheating. Understanding the specific energy requirements and operating environment of your device helps ensure you pick a battery that enhances safety and efficiency.
When selecting batteries, consider keeping these points in mind:
- Manufacturer Recommendations: Always prioritize batteries recommended by your device’s maker, as they test compatibility and safety rigorously.
- Battery Age: Even unopened batteries degrade over time; using fresh batteries minimizes the risk of leakage.
- Usage Environment: Extreme temperatures can cause many battery types to malfunction or leak, so choose batteries designed for your specific conditions.
- Proper Storage: Keep spare batteries in original packaging or a dedicated battery case to avoid short circuits and damage.
Emergency Response and First Aid for Battery-Related Incidents
In the event of a battery leak or explosion, immediate action can greatly reduce harm. If you come into contact with battery acid, avoid rubbing the affected area and rinse thoroughly with plenty of water for at least 15 minutes. Remove any contaminated clothing carefully to prevent further skin exposure. If battery acid gets into the eyes, flush them gently but continuously with water and seek emergency medical assistance without delay. For inhalation of fumes from a leaking or exploding battery, swiftly move to fresh air and monitor for symptoms such as difficulty breathing or dizziness. Prompt medical evaluation is crucial in serious cases.
Having a well-stocked first aid kit nearby and understanding the right steps to take can make all the difference during battery-related emergencies. Keep these essentials in mind:
- Wear protective gloves when handling damaged batteries to avoid chemical burns.
- Use neutralizing agents like baking soda to safely clean small acid spills before wiping.
- Avoid direct contact with battery fluids and promptly dispose of leaking batteries in accordance with local hazardous waste regulations.
- Call emergency services if there is fire, explosion, or if anyone experiences severe symptoms.
